Update
Just want to let everyone know that our patrol of the Buck Rock Trail and the Cheater Trail went extremely well.
It was a beautiful day on the mountain and the Trail was in the best condition i've seen.
As of 6/6 the trail and surrounding area were clear of trees and debris, trail markers and barriers were also ok, so lets all plan on enjoying a safe 2015 season.

And yes as Dave mentioned, I was able to run up and inspect the trail on Monday and over all it looked great, I only saw one bypass that the Forrest Service created, I did not get to check the cheater trail section but maybe this Saturday we can look at it as well as other parts of the mountain. All the regular bypasses looked good and the backfires the Forrest service set actually helped by burning back brush along the trail. It looks like minor stuff and trash pick-up on the Buck Rock side, there maybe more elsewhere.
Bring Gloves, safety glasses and trail tools, I will bring a saw if we need it.
